At what age do people have gallbladder problems?
According to a study of trends in gallbladder disease, patients experiencing symptomatic gallstones tend to be younger today than in previous decades, often presenting in their thirties or forties. While increasing age remains a significant risk factor, this shift is attributed to rising obesity and diabetes rates, indicating that gallbladder problems can affect individuals across a broad age range, not just the elderly.
